ISLE OF WIGHT - A man was apparently shot during a Civil War re-enactment over the weekend in Isle of Wight County.
The 72-year-old man, who was not identified by police, was apparently shot during a re-enactment at Heritage Park. He was flown to Sentara Norfolk General Hospital.
